Lesson Plan: Summer Break - Exploring Nature
Introduction: - Greet the students and ask them about their summer break experiences so far. - Explain that today’s lesson is all about exploring nature during the summer break. - Share the objectives of the lesson: to learn about different aspects of nature, develop observation skills, and appreciate the beauty of the natural world.
Lesson Outline: 1. Warm-up Activity: Summer Nature Scavenger Hunt (10 minutes) - Provide each student with a printed copy of the Summer Nature Scavenger Hunt worksheet (link: Worksheet Resource). - Explain the instructions and encourage students to find and check off the items on the list during their summer break. - Emphasize the importance of observing and respecting nature while completing the scavenger hunt.
- Video: “The Wonders of Nature” (15 minutes)
- Show the video “The Wonders of Nature” (link: Video Resource) to the students.
- Pause the video at certain points to ask questions and encourage discussion.
- Questions:
- What are some examples of nature shown in the video?
- How does nature make you feel?
- Why is it important to take care of nature?
- Group Activity: Nature Collage (20 minutes)
- Divide the students into small groups.
- Provide each group with a large sheet of paper, glue, and a variety of natural materials such as leaves, flowers, twigs, and pebbles.
- Instruct the students to work together to create a nature collage using the provided materials.
- Encourage creativity and discussion within the groups.
- Assessment: Nature Quiz (10 minutes)
- Distribute the Nature Quiz worksheet (link: Worksheet Resource).
- Ask the students to complete the quiz individually.
- Collect the quizzes for assessment purposes.
Differentiation: - For students who may need additional support, provide visual aids or simplified versions of the worksheets. - For students who may need extension activities, encourage them to write a short paragraph describing their favorite nature experience during the summer break.
Plenary: - Gather the students together and ask them to share their nature collages with the class. - Discuss the different elements of nature depicted in the collages and the students’ experiences during the summer break. - Recap the key points learned during the lesson and emphasize the importance of appreciating and protecting nature.
